Walking Therapy in San Clemente
For many people, healing comes easier when they’re moving. Something shifts when you’re outdoors—the nervous system softens, the body settles, and thoughts untangle in ways that feel more natural and less pressured than sitting face-to-face in an office.
At Denney Family Therapy in San Clemente, we offer Walking Therapy for clients who feel most comfortable processing emotions in motion or who find grounding through fresh air, gentle movement, and the natural rhythm of the outdoors.
Walking Therapy isn’t a fitness session. It’s therapy—just in a different setting. A slower pace. A calmer nervous system. A little more room to breathe.
Why Walking Therapy Helps
Therapy outdoors can feel especially supportive if you:
feel more open when you’re not sitting across from someone
get anxious in traditional therapy settings
appreciate nature as a grounding resource
think more clearly while moving
find stillness overwhelming
feel emotionally “stuck” and need a shift in environment
want a space that feels less formal and more human
Movement helps regulate the nervous system, making difficult conversations easier to access and process. For many clients, this gentle rhythm makes therapy feel safer, deeper, and more authentic.

What Walking Therapy Looks Like
Sessions take place on quiet walking routes in San Clemente, moving at a pace that feels comfortable for you. There is no rush, no agenda, and no expectation to “perform.” You set the pace—emotionally and physically.
We may explore:
grounding and nervous system regulation
stress, anxiety, or grief
relationship patterns
identity shifts or life transitions
trauma recovery (when appropriate and safe for outdoor work)
overwhelm, burnout, and emotional fatigue
Some clients pair Walking Therapy with traditional indoor sessions or EMDR therapy, while others use it as their primary therapeutic space. You choose what fits.

Safety, Comfort & Emotional Pace
Your comfort matters.
We choose routes that are:
safe
easy to navigate
You’re always welcome to pause, sit, walk slower, or shift direction at any time. Therapy outdoors should feel spacious—not overstimulating or exposed.
Walking Therapy is always grounded in trauma-informed care. If a session brings up deeper trauma work that requires controlled conditions, we’ll transition back indoors or integrate EMDR in a way that feels safe.
